Artificial insemination, also known as intrauterine insemination (IUI), is a technique that involves placing sperm directly into a woman’s uterus to facilitate fertilization. This method bypasses the need for natural intercourse and can be done with a partner’s sperm or donor sperm. Natural conception, on the other hand, occurs when sperm fertilizes an egg during sexual intercourse. While it may seem like a simple process, there are many factors that can affect the success of natural conception, such as timing, sperm quality, and fertility issues.
One of the main advantages of artificial insemination is its accessibility. It is a relatively simple and non-invasive procedure that can be done in a doctor’s office without the need for anesthesia. This makes it a more affordable option for couples who are struggling with fertility issues. Additionally, artificial insemination allows for the use of donor sperm, which can expand the options for single women or same-sex couples who want to have a child.
In contrast, natural conception requires timing and may not always be successful, even for healthy couples. Women have a limited window of fertility each month, and missing this window can significantly decrease the chances of conception. Additionally, factors such as age, hormonal imbalances, and health conditions can affect a woman’s fertility and make natural conception more challenging.
